Meaning & origin

Athalene is a rare American name first recorded in 1915. Its usage peaked in 1926, with modest popularity during the 1920s before declining sharply. The name likely follows the early-20th-century fashion for names ending in -ene or -lene, such as Ethelene or Marlene, rather than stemming from any ancient origin. The trajectory of Athalene has been stable at extremely low usage since its peak, with no recorded top states suggesting concentrated regional popularity. Its meaning remains uncertain, adding to its mystique for parents seeking a distinctive choice with vintage charm.

Athalene is a rare name first recorded in the United States in 1915. It may be a variant of Athalie, the French form of the Hebrew name Athaliah, meaning 'God is exalted,' but there is no direct evidence linking them. More likely, Athalene is a modern coinage, perhaps blending elements of names like Athena or Ethel with the popular suffix -lene, common in the early 20th century. Its usage peaked in the 1920s and has since remained very rare.
